When a bomb that is detonated atop City Hall blinds photographer, Rachel Newton, Jarod "Nobel" joins the Detroit bomb squad to prove that one of their own men is actually the "Fax Bomber" who is responsible.
Daniel Carlson, a member of the Detroit bomb squad, has been planting bombs all over the city in order to deactivate them and play the hero. To avoid being caught, Carlson sets up a disgruntled city worker, Curtis Haring, to take the blame. Paranoid, a loner who lives in his mother's basement, Haring makes the perfect patsy while providing Carlson with yet another opportunity to be a hero, when he "catches" Haring, just as he (supposedly) nearly blows himself up.
Realizing that Rachel must have seen the person who set the bomb that blinded her, Jarod creates a simulation involving Rachel's dark room in order to help her remember what it is that she saw just before the explosion. When he is certain that Carlson is the real "Fax Bomber," Jarod puts Daniel in a situation where the man believes that he will die if he cannot deactivate a bomb with the same amount of dexterity and finesse with which he has supposedly been deactivating the "Fax Bomber's" explosive devices. Unable to do it, Carlson confesses and is arrested by Lt. Chromsky, his boss.
Mr. Raines orders lie-detector tests for Miss Parker, Sydney and Broots to attempt to discover who is leaking information from The Centre. All of them are cleared, but not before Miss Parker and Sydney discover that Broots is in a custody battle with his ex-wife over his daughter, Debbie.
Angelo continues to search the Internet for signs of Jarod, but when he finds one - in the form of a picture of Jarod's mother - he keeps Mr. Raines from seeing it.
